ART’S WAY ANNOUNCES SIGNIFICANT INCREASE IN

BACKLOG FOLLOWING AWARD OF MAJOR

MODULAR BUILDING PROJECTS

ARMSTRONG, IOWA, August 10, 2026 – Art’s-Way Manufacturing Co., Inc. (Nasdaq: ARTW) (the “Company”), a diversified manufacturer and distributor of equipment serving agricultural and research needs, announces that its Modular Buildings segment has been awarded major projects recently, increasing the segment’s backlog to over $19.0 million, a significant increase since the $1.3 million reported in the Company’s Quarterly Report on Form 10-Q for the fiscal quarter ended May 31, 2026.

These projects represent a significant increase in the Modular Building segment’s production commitments and provide enhanced visibility into future manufacturing activity. The backlog is estimated to be substantially fulfilled by the end of the Company’s 2027 fiscal year, subject to customer schedules, project milestones and customary execution.

Marc McConnell, the Company’s President, CEO, and Chairman, reports, “We are pleased to announce the award of these significant projects, which reflect the strength of our modular manufacturing capabilities and the confidence our customers have placed in our team. These projects substantially strengthen our backlog and position the Company for an extended period of production activity. We remain focused on executing these projects efficiently and at the high level of quality and service our customers expect.”

The Company is not disclosing the identities of the customers or additional project details at this time due to the contractual confidentiality obligations. Should the customers agree to joint press release in the future the Company may release more information related to the projects.

The Company expects these projects to be executed at margins generally consistent with its historical performance for comparable Modular Buildings projects.

Backlog represents the estimated value of signed customer contracts that have not yet been completed. While backlog provides an indication of future business activity, it is subject to customer requirements, contract terms, scheduling changes, and other factors. Accordingly, backlog is not necessarily indicative of future revenue, operating results, or the timing of revenue recognition.

Art’s-Way Manufacturing Co., Inc.

Art’s Way Manufacturing is a small, publicly traded company that specializes in equipment manufacturing. For over 65 years, it has been committed to designing and building high-quality machinery for all operations. It has approximately 100 employees across two branch locations: Art’s Way Manufacturing in Armstrong, Iowa and Art’s Way Scientific in Monona, Iowa. Art’s Way manure spreaders, forage boxes, high dump carts, bale processors, graders, land planes, sugar beet harvesters and grinder mixers are designed to optimize production, increase efficiency and meet the growing demands of customers. Art’s Way Manufacturing has two reporting segments: Agricultural Products and Modular Buildings.
